使用print函数输出printa.__doc__,查看函printa函数说明。
时间: 2024-03-08 09:44:19 浏览: 109
使用print函数输出printa.__doc__可以查看函数printa的说明文档。printa.__doc__是函数对象的一个属性,它返回函数的文档字符串(docstring)。文档字符串是对函数功能和使用方法的描述,通常用于提供函数的说明和帮助信息。
下面是一个示例代码:
```python
def printa():
"""
This is a function that prints 'a'.
"""
print('a')
print(printa.__doc__)
```
输出结果为:
```
This is a function that prints 'a'.
```
相关问题
2.在printa函数下面添加如下所示多行注释,并使用print函数输出printa.__doc__,查
在printa函数的下方添加多行注释,可以通过使用三个单引号或三个双引号来实现。在注释中可以对函数进行详细的说明,包括参数、返回值、功能等等。
'''
这是一个用于打印字符串的自定义函数printa。
参数:
- str:需要打印的字符串
返回值:
- 无
功能:
- 将传入的字符串打印到控制台
'''
def printa(str):
'''
这是一个用于打印字符串的自定义函数printa。
参数:
- str:需要打印的字符串
返回值:
- 无
功能:
- 将传入的字符串打印到控制台
'''
print(str)
print(printa.__doc__)
'''
这段代码输出函数printa的文档字符串,即函数定义时的注释部分。
输出结果:
这是一个用于打印字符串的自定义函数printa。
参数:
- str:需要打印的字符串
返回值:
- 无
功能:
- 将传入的字符串打印到控制台
'''
列Python奙夿的奀出奐奩奃________。 def aFunction(): "The quick brown fox" return 1 print(aFunction.__doc__[4:9])
该程序的输出结果为 `quick`。
程序定义了一个名为 `aFunction` 的函数,并在函数体内添加了一个文档字符串 `"The quick brown fox"`。然后,程序通过 `print` 函数输出了 `aFunction.__doc__[4:9]`,该表达式的含义是截取 `aFunction` 函数的文档字符串的第 5 个字符(从 0 开始计数,即字母 q)到第 9 个字符(即字母 k)之间的子串。因此,程序的输出结果为 `quick`。
阅读全文